Location

• In the heart of Mexico City's historic center, near the Zócalo main square, the Metropolitan Cathedral, and Templo Mayor ruins. • The neighborhood offers the Palacio de Bellas Artes cultural center, museums like Museo del Estanquillo, traditional cantinas, and Plaza de la Constitución. • The Plaza de Santo Domingo, Mercado de Artesanías, and Alameda Central park are ideal for history and culture enthusiasts.
